I searched through some threads but didn't find a real answer. There are many 63-66 Dart's here. Anybody run 15x8 SS's without jacking the thing sky high or cutting and hacking? I know 15x7's will fit. Anybody try 8's? (4 1/2" backspace) tmm

it'll be tight dude, i just put some 17x7's w/a 4.25 bs on my car (66 valiant w/no wheel well/spring mods) it's lowered two inches, so the wheel/tire combo had to be right on, and these wheels fit perfect, there about an inch from the spring, and about 1/2 to 3/4" from the outside of the well. so, total width of the tire (sidewall to sidewall) will play a factor, the total width on my tire is 9.8 inches, and the tread width is 9.4 inches. your bs is only a 1/4" more, so they'll fit but will be tight, that's why total width is going to be important..........there's a 66 barracuda on the tech archive forum under the a body wheel/tire sizes thread........this guy has 17x8's w/4.5 bs on his car, and he had to do some minor mods to the drivers side spring because of the rearend he has, but other than that they fit, chk. it out.

Toolmanmike.....I have 8"X15" cop wheels on my '65 Valiant (all 4 corners) with 215-60 tires on the rear. With careful attention to back spacing you should be able to fit a set of 235-60 tires on the back. 225-60 for sure. I think a 7" wheel with 4 1/2" back spacing is where I need to be, the 8" wheel pushes the sidewall bulge out a tad too far. My fronts have 195-60 tires on them but that is what was there when I bought the cqr.
Higgs.....what is your tire size, especially the diameter? Did you use lowering blocks to drop the rear? If so, ain't adjusting the rear brakes fun?

my tires are 245/45/17's, the diameter is just under 26 inches i believe, also i was slightly wrong on the width/tread above, those are numbers off a hoosier tire that i almost bought.........total width on these are 9.4, and tread is about 9 inches on the ground......the car is lowered w/2 inch lowering blocks, so yes, it can be fun adjusting the brakes lol.......

Thanks, Higgs. If I go away from the 15 wheels I was looking at a 235-50R17 tire. It is a 9.6" section width, 8.4" tread width, and 26.3" diameter. It is .2" wider at the bulge than yours but maybe 4.5" of back spacing will work?

A few years ago I put a pair of 15x8 Cragar SS's on my D/Dart just to see if they would fit. I think the tire size was 275/60 x15. They are older BFG Drag Radials. They didn't fit. Too much tire cross sectional width. You'd need a 235 or 255 tire.

I can check the actual tire and rim specs later this week if you want me too.

My Dart has SS springs on it.

not early A body but later like my 70 Swinger will fit 255X60X15 on these Wheel Vintiques Small Bolt Wheels I have and get all of it into the wheel well without hitting anything and leaving about an inch clearance on each side. Backspace is critical though. Mine have 4 5/8 backspace. With this backspace 15X8 fit too but the tire is about a 1/4 of an inch from the fender lip. If you have wheels with at least 4 1/2 inch backspace 15, 16, or 17X7 wheels should fit your car with the 255X60 tires as I have seen tires this size on early Darts and Valiants at shows. What this means is there is not much difference from early to later a body when there is low and small wheel openings.
